    The Surge 2 is a 2019 action role-playing video game developed by Deck13 Interactive and published by Focus Home Interactive, that is the sequel to The Surge. The game was released for PlayStation 4, Windows, and Xbox One on 24 September 2019, while an Amazon Luna version released on 20 October 2020. It received positive reviews from critics.

    Fandom (website) Fandom [a] (formerly known as Wikicities and Wikia [b]) is a wiki hosting service that hosts wikis mainly on entertainment topics (i.e., video games, TV series, movies, entertainers, etc.). [9] The privately held, for-profit Delaware company was founded in October 2004 by Wikipedia co-founder Jimmy Wales and Angela Beesley.
